以太坊隱私技術實作教學完整指南:Aztec、Railgun、Privacy Pools 程式碼範例與深度技術分析(2025-2026)

本文深入探討以太坊三大主流隱私技術——Aztec Network、Railgun 與 Privacy Pools——的實作細節,提供可直接部署的程式碼範例與技術分析。涵蓋各協議的核心智慧合約架構、零知識證明電路設計、SDK 整合方式、以及真實攻擊案例與防護策略。我們提供完整的 Noir 語言範例、TypeScript SDK 使用指南、Solidity 智慧合約代碼,以及前端 React 整合範例。

隱私技術實作教程 2026

工具棧

工具
電路Circom, Noir
證明snarkjs, nargo
合約Hardhat, Foundry
SDKAztec SDK

開發流程

1. 設計電路 → 2. 編譯 → 3. 信任設置 → 4. 生成證明 → 5. 部署合約

Circom 實作

pragma circom 2.1.6;

template SimpleProof() {
    signal input a;
    signal input b;
    signal output c;
    
    c <== a * b;
}

部署

npx hardhat deploy --network mainnet

結語

動手做是學習的最佳方式。

COMMIT: Add privacy technology implementation tutorial 2026

延伸閱讀與來源

這篇文章對您有幫助嗎?

評論

發表評論

注意:由於這是靜態網站,您的評論將儲存在本地瀏覽器中,不會公開顯示。

目前尚無評論,成為第一個發表評論的人吧!